LINUX.ORG.RU

Клонирование системы и резервное копирование

 , ,


0

1

Приветствую!

Я только что купил второй компьютер и хочу создать две идентичные системы (чтобы мне было удобно работать на обоих).

Мне нужно однократное клонирование, а не синхронизация в реальном времени.

Первый компьютер — Asus Rog strix g16, второй — GEEKOM A6 Mini PC.

Есть ли способ это сделать?

Система Ubuntu 25 оба.


И еще один вопрос:

Мне нужно сохранять резервные копии для обеих систем.

У меня есть внешний SSD-накопитель объемом 6 ТБ (ext4), который я использую для резервного копирования на своем ноутбуке. Могу ли я использовать его также для резервного копирования на Geekom?

Я пытался это сделать, но Timeshift создает папку «timeshift» в корневом каталоге диска и мешает другим резервным копиям.

хочу создать две идентичные системы (чтобы мне было удобно работать на обоих).

Live, она-же бэкап.

Есть ли способ это сделать?

Есть. Но… Первый - nVidia, второй - AMD. Поэтому, не нужно клонировать.

Timeshift создает папку «timeshift» в корневом каталоге диска.

Настрой timeshift.

andytux ★★★★★
()

Если вот вообще в тупую без всяких нюансов. То тебе нужно сделать два шага. В наличие комп1(эталон) и комп2(сюда будет залита копия эталона). Также надо загрузочную флэшку с живой системой (любой, лично я использую федора). Также надо внешний носитель для хранения копии оригинала/эталона, подключаемый либо внутрь компа, либо по usb (у тебя вроде он есть).

Шаг 1

подключаешь внешний носитель в комп1 и загрузочную флэшку. Включаешь комп, загружаешь живую систему, запускаешь команду «lsblk», смотришь где какой диск (с какими буквами). Пусть sda — эталон, sdb — внешний ssd, sdc — флэшка с живой системой. монтируешь нужный раздел внешнего ssd например /dev/sdb2 --> /run/media/ext_ssd_sdb2. Создаёшь диру для хранения копии эталона «mkdir /run/media/ext_ssd_sdb2/2025-11-30». И собственно создаешь копию всего эталона. «dd if=/dev/sda of=/run/media/ext_ssd_sdb2/2025-11-30/etalon.dsk bs=16M status=progress». Ясен пень это всё делается от рута.

Шаг 2

Идёшь к компу 2, с флэшкой и внешним хранилищем. Также включаешь. Грузишь живую систему. запускаешь команду «lsblk». смотришь где какой диск (с какими буквами), запускаешь команду «lsblk», смотришь где какой диск (с какими буквами). Пусть sda — новый комп (пустышка), sdb — внешний ssd, sdc — флэшка с живой системой. монтируешь нужный раздел внешнего ssd например /dev/sdb2 --> /run/media/ext_ssd_sdb2. Внимательно думаешь, что именно ты сейчас хочешь сделать. Потом запускаешь команду создания клона «dd if=/run/media/ext_ssd_sdb2/2025-11-30/etalon.dsk of=/dev/sda bs=16M status=progress». Никаких предупреждений при этом тебе выдаваться не будет. Ты сделаешь ровно то, что хотел: уничтожишь всё что было на компе 2 и там появится полная копия компа 1. В качестве бонуса можешь до уничтожения всего также на всякий случай сделать копию второго компа на внешнем носителе «dd if=/dev/sda of=/run/media/ext_ssd_sdb2/2025-11-30/zhertva-aborta.dsk bs=16M status=progress»

Шаг 0

Подразумеваем, что диски на комп 1 и комп 2 равны между собой по размеру. И на внешнем носителе есть свободное место, чтобы вместить в себя минимум один образ диска.

justAmoment ★★★★★
()